History of Creation

The developer of this unique helicopter was ML Mil. Initially, the creator called his brainchild GM-1. Helicopterbeen developed for many years. Dozens of engineers studied the developments of foreign colleagues and the experience of Soviet developers.

It is worth noting that at that time the USSR was armed with only one helicopter engine, which was developed by A. G. Ivchenko. The power unit could reach speeds of up to 500-550 hp. It was this engine of the Mi-1 helicopter that became the first and most famous.

Initially, the GM-1 was designed as a communications vehicle. It was assumed that two passengers and a pilot could be accommodated on board the helicopter. At the same time, the helicopter looked very much like models that can be seen in the air today.

Mi-1 helicopter: description

The machine is equipped with a main rotor with a diameter of just over 14 meters and a tail rotor with a diameter of 2.5 m. The blades of the unit taper towards the end and are attached to the hub using vertical and horizontal swivel joints.

Already at that time, the design of the Mi-1 helicopter implied the presence of friction dampers. They are designed to dampen the vibrations that are created during the operation of the blades. Moreover, the last elements require special attention.

Blade design features

These items are among the most important. The blades are of mixed design. It contains steel telescopic tubes, wooden stringers and ribs. Sheathing is made of dense plywood.

The Mi-1 helicopter is equipped with blades with variable cyclic pitch. It changes depending on the position of the swashplate, which is located under the hub.

Also, the developer faced the issue of eliminating the loss of stability of the mechanism. Miles decided to use a special cardan in the blade control roller.

Fuselage

The body of the aircraft can be divided into front, center and rear parts. The frontal zone consists of a welded truss, to which the frame of the helicopter cabin itself (including duralumin skin) is connected.

The middle part of the aircraft is a glazed cockpit that can accommodate the pilot and several passengers, for whom there is a two-seat sofa (located behind the seat of the one who controls the aircraft). Behind it is the engine compartment, in which the motor, the main gearbox of the two-stage type, the brake, the combined clutch are installed. Also in the rear, behind the cab, there is a 240-liter gas tank. If necessary (if a longer flight was planned), it was possible to install another container with gasoline.

Also in the rear of the fuselage is a tail boom made of solid metal. There is also a transmission shaft and an intermediate type gearbox. At the very end, a three-bladed tail propeller is installed.

How the tests went

The first experimental aircraft were produced at the airbase in Kyiv. However, after the release of the prototype model, the developers were faced with the task of testing it. To do this, it was decided to transfer the Mi-1 helicopter to another airfield, located in Zakharkovo.

September 20 of the same year was first performedflying this aircraft. At the same time, the helicopter was able to hover in the air on a binding. After another 10 days, the GM-1 made its first full-fledged flight and reached speeds, first to 50, and then to 100 km/h.

However, not everything went so smoothly. For example, the first two helicopters could not cope with the task and were lost. The first prototype crashed in late autumn 1948. During the flight, the lubrication of the control mechanisms froze. Because of this, the pilot had to urgently leave the device. At that moment, pilot K. Baikalov was flying the helicopter. He stayed alive. The next accident occurred in the spring of 1949. Since the welding was of poor quality, the propeller shaft of the helicopter simply fell apart. At that moment, Baikalov was also driving the car. Unfortunately, the pilot did not have time to leave the unit and died.

Despite the fact that two experimental models at once could not prove their suitability and the rather skeptical attitude of some models, development continued. Therefore, in the summer of 1949, a third machine was created with a modified tail shaft. Engineers have eliminated the need for welding, which would require increased attention and quality of work. A new type of lubricant for control mechanisms has also been developed. The new fluid was resistant to low temperatures.

Mil decided to limit the unit's flight altitude to 3,000 meters. In the autumn of the same year, the first tests began, which were successfully completed by November.

Refining the model

Despite the rather successful tests, the military had some comments on the device. First of all, they wanted to improve the control technique to make piloting easier. It also needed to reduce vibration levels and simplify ground operations.

In 1950, taking into account all the comments, the GM-1 was finalized and passed a new series of tests, including an emergency landing if the car is in autorotation mode. After that, the helicopter was handed over to the military. They did more testing. The machine was tested for the possibility of landing in mountainous terrain.

In 1950, the state decided to create a series of experimental models of 15 GM-1 machines, which for the first time were to receive their final name Mi-1. As many note, at that time the importance of the aircraft was underestimated not only by the military, but also in the national economy. Therefore, Mil's "first-born" Mi-1 helicopter entered large-scale production with a delay. However, the situation changed radically when the experimental model was shown to IV Stalin. He was also informed that the development of rotary-wing technology is also being carried out in the United States. Therefore, it was decided that it was time to mass-produce the Mi-1 airborne transport helicopter, the photo of which shows that it is the basis of most modern models.

First production models

Transport aviation pilots underwent retraining in Serpukhov and gradually mastered new aircraft. The state planned the mass launch of the Mi-1 helicopter and introduce it into transport aviation. However, the apparatus was more widely used in motorized rifle divisions, which were later transformed into squadrons. After repeated tests in Serpukhov, the military had almost no complaints about the helicopter. However, there were comments regarding the operation of the maintenance features of the units on the ground.

Use area

The picture shows the Mi-1 helicopter (picture above) and it looks like a military vehicle, and it was really widely used for a variety of purposes. For example, he entered service with the courier services. The aircraft was used in reconnaissance and for patrolling the borders, rescue operations and sanitation.

For the first time, the Mi-1 helicopter took part in hostilities in 1956, when the so-called Hungarian events took place. Later, military vehicles were used in Czechoslovakia for the same purposes.

However, few people know that it was originally planned to use a helicopter to train pilots flying propeller-driven vehicles. Therefore, MI-1 also entered military schools.

Also, the helicopter was used in the economic sector. MI-1 was successfully used to transport people, parcels and other small cargo. With the help of aircraft of this type, chemical treatment of farms was carried out. Helicopters were also used for whale reconnaissance, checking forests and much more. Since 1954, MI-1 has appeared in Civil Aviation. Gradually, the helicopter began to be used for peaceful purposes around the world.

Attitude towards aircraft abroad

The MI-1 model had excellent flight qualities. Moreover, as many as 27 world records were set on this machine, which for that time was an amazing result. For example, in 1959, pilot F. I. Belushkin managed to fly an aircraft to a height of 6700 meters. A little later, the MI-1 helicopter speed record was set. Pilot V. V. Vinitsky was able to accelerate the car to 210 km/h.

It is worth noting that in all its characteristics this model has never been inferior to Western counterparts. Foreign pilots who got the opportunity to operate this unit noted that this model is a breakthrough in the field of helicopter construction. Thanks to this, the Mi-1 gained worldwide popularity and began to enter service with many countries.

For example, the aircraft is widely accepted in China. There, the Mi-1 helicopter was used in many police operations. In Egypt, the car took part in conflicts with the Israeli side.

Starting from 1955, the production of the Mi-1 was transferred to Poland, where the serial production of the model began. The foreign unit was named SM-1. By and large, it was with this model that the helicopter industry began in this country. Until 1965, more than 1680 helicopters rolled off the assembly lines. Most of them were sent back to the USSR.

Follow-up developments

Of course, after such a success, the improvement of the helicopter continued. Engineers have focused on improved design, as well as the reliability of the aircraft. Against this background, by 1956The spars of the helicopter blades were replaced with one-piece elements made of durable steel pipes.

A year later, the helicopter was equipped with already pressed spars. However, at that time, the country's metallurgy was not at such a high level as it is now, so the specialists did not have enough experience in pressing long profiles. Therefore, a new technology had to be developed to create more reliable elements.

Subsequently, the Mi-1 and Mi-2 helicopters (new versions were assembled in Poland from parts sent from the USSR in 1965) were equipped with more advanced controls. The system has become more complete and has combined all the necessary nodes. The helicopter also received a controlled stabilizer, external suspension and anti-icing systems.

Subsequent upgrades have become more convenient. For example, it became possible to transport four passengers at once. The double sofa was also behind the pilot. But two more additional seats appeared, which were located next to the pilot. Specifications have been improved. The helicopter was equipped with more voluminous gas tanks of 600 liters. Thanks to all this, the car was able to make longer flights and climb to a greater height. The problems of servicing the device on the ground and in severe weather conditions were solved.

Highly specialized modifications of helicopters have also appeared. For example, there are models that are equipped with a wider door, which helps to install a stretcher with victims inside the cabin. Therefore, with the power of the aircraft, it became possible to carry outrescue work. It is noteworthy that some were skeptical that stretchers and other equipment would not adversely affect the functionality of the helicopter. However, during the tests, no problems arose. In terms of their functionality, the upgraded models are in no way inferior to the first Mi-1 in terms of their technical characteristics and other indicators.
